Cotton growers miss out of rising prices

From Daily News, Dar es Salaam
By business standard reporter

THOUSDANDS of cotton growers in the Western Cotton Growing Area - Shinyanga, Mwanza and Mara regions - are haplessly watching as the cash crop price escalates, reaching to levels that had never been thought of in the history of marketing the crop in Tanzania.

The increase of price from last year’s 360/- to 600/- per kilogramme that cotton growers and Tanzania Cotton Board (TCB) settled for as initial price when the crop buying season started in early June seems to have overwhelmed majority cotton growers who, as a result, rushed to sell their produce at the price they probably perceived too high to be true. Experts’ calls to wait a bit, for there were evident prospects of price rise, fell on deaf ears.
